In a small bowl, combine honey, soy sauce, sesame oil, vinegar, garlic, ginger, and sesame seeds.
02 -
Dry off cod filets with a paper towel, then set them into a glass dish. Coat with a tablespoon of sauce, cover, and chill in the fridge for 30 minutes or up to 2 hours. Save the rest of the sauce for later.
03 -
Adjust the oven rack to be near the top and set the broiler to low. Lay parchment paper on a baking pan and place the fish on top.
04 -
Cook under low heat for 12 to 14 minutes, adding more sauce every few minutes. For the last 4-5 minutes, turn the broiler to high until golden and the fish reaches 135-140°F inside.
05 -
Move the cooked fish to plates and sprinkle with the sliced green onions.
